The graph below represents the path of a grasshopper as it jumps.
On a coordinate plane, distance is on the x-axis and height is on the y-axis. A curve starts at (0, 0) and increases to (10, 6). It then decreases until it reaches (18, 0)
Which type of function models the data on the graph?
inverse variation
linear
square root
quadratic

Quadratic.
The graph rises to a single maximum then falls back to zero, which is the shape of a parabola (projectile motion), not linear, inverse, or square-root.
